Probability of Days with Accumulation of Cold Air in the Gavkhooni Etang, by Using MarkovChain Model

Topographic conditions of the ground surface are intensively effective on the climatic moderate phenomena. Etangs are considered more or less the focal point of accumulation of cold air during the night and may cause the appearance of air temperature collapse. Normal of the air temperature in synoptic and climatological stations shows   such conditions for Gavkhoni etang. In this research, Markov Chain model was used for determining the probability of occurrence of days with settlement of cold air in Gavkhoni etang in different seasons of the year.
Therefore, the minimum difference of  daily air temperature at the two climatic stations of Varzaneh and Isfahan in statistical  period (2005-1986), was obtained  And  with respect to its sign ( negative or positive) , the days of the year were divided  in two categories  of ordinary days with code (zero) and the  days  with accumulation of cold air in etang with  code (1).
 The results showed that %71.5 of the days of the year had the settlement of cold air in Gavkhooni etang.
The number of the days with accumulation of cold air in  the autumn, winter , spring , and Summer  were %79.5, %73.8, %71.9 and %61.1respectively. In cases of conditional transition of temperature, the probability of p11occurance is more than other conditions ( ، ، ). Regression relation between the observed and estimated values of n periods of cold air settlement shows that the considered accuracy and reliability for all seasons is more than 99%.
